We are currently working with a world-class specialist vehicle manufacturer developing a full range of EV Vehicles. We are recruiting for a Principal Engineer - Body Structures. The main responsibilities of this role will be to create and manipulate geometry for primary communication of concepts/schemes.
Responsibilities:
1. Support the Lead Engineer, Body & Closures in all day-to-day activities.
2. Utilize Catia to lead the development of the 3D models for body structures.
3. Engineering BoM development, cost/weight pack development, and weight BoM management.
4. Design surface (CAS) feasibility 'FC' checks and provide feasibility advice & guidance.
5. Engineering hard-point generation.
6. Benchmarking of competitor vehicles & reporting of findings.
7. Interface with cross-functional teams (Package, Analysis, Manufacturing, DVA, etc.) & implement recommendations to create a right first-time release.
8. Store and release data into TCUA and PLM.
Qualifications:
1. A relevant engineering qualification with proven experience in the design of body structures.
2. Proven experience in automotive or motorsport applications as part of an OEM, Tier 1, or consultancy, with the ability to use CAD (Catia).
3. Experience in the complete vehicle development cycle for body structures.
